Ignition coil has a pronounced "white strip" by the coil core that is obviously insulation that is decayed and opening up to expose the windings. Factory tells the dealer it is normal. It is obvious to the untrained eye that the windings are just under the surface of the insulation. It is a suspected problem that has caused erratic engine running characteristics.
